How to study for the HAM exams came up in last night's net. The best way I found to study was using The HAM Whisperer's videos.

http://www.hamwhisperer.com/p/ham-courses.html

The General portion is, technically, outdated but I only found 1 or 2 questions that weren't covered in this FREE course.

I also used an Android app called Ham Radio Study. Also FREE! There is no pass or fail with this app. It keeps throwing questions at you until you've mastered them all.

With these two methods, I passed the Tech and General in just over 1/2 hour.
